Skip to content

Latest commit

 

History

History
36 lines (33 loc) · 8.94 KB

DEPENDENCIES.md

File metadata and controls

36 lines (33 loc) · 8.94 KB

Flowblade Package Dependencies

Description Debian package name Ubuntu package name Archlinux packages
MLT Python bindings (MLT version 7.0 required, 7.12 and above recommended) python3-mlt python3-mlt mlt
Decoder/Encoder application ffmpeg ffmpeg ffmpeg
Additional library for MLT libmlt-data libmlt-data mlt, sdl_image
Language and interpreter python3 python3 python
Additional video filters frei0r-plugins frei0r-plugins movit, frei0r-plugins
Additional audio filters swh-plugins swh-plugins sox, swh-plugins
SVG support librsvg2-common librsvg2-common librsvg
Framework for image processing gmic gmic gmic
GTK and related libraries
GTK3 Python bindings python3-gi python3-gi python-gobject
Glib gir1.2-glib-2.0 gir1.2-glib-2.0 dbus-glib ???
Pango text lib gir1.2-pango-1.0 gir1.2-pango-1.0 pango
Image support gir1.2-gdkpixbuf-2.0 gir1.2-gdkpixbuf-2.0 gdk-pixbuf2
Gi Cairo bindings python3-gi-cairo python3-gi-cairo python-cairo
Gtk toolkit gir1.2-gtk-3.0 gir1.2-gtk-3.0 gtk3
Python Dependencies
PIL image manipulation library python3-pil python-pil python-pillow
Math and arrays library python3-numpy python3-numpy python-numpy
USB support python3-libusb1 python-libusb1 python-libusb1

Dropped Dependencies

Debian/Ubuntu package name Introduced Dropped
melt 0.6 0.8
fontconfig 0.6 0.16
python-gtk2 0.6 1.2
gtk2-engines-pixbuf 0.6 1.2
python-gnome2 0.6 1.2
python-gobject-2 0.6 1.2
python-cairo 0.6 1.6
DBus python bindings 0.12 2.12